org.jetbrains.kotlin.codegen
Class PackageCodegen

java.lang.Object
  extended by org.jetbrains.kotlin.codegen.PackageCodegen

public class PackageCodegen
extends java.lang.Object


Constructor Summary
PackageCodegen(GenerationState state, java.util.Collection<JetFile> files, FqName fqName)
           
 
Method Summary
 void done()
           
 void generate(CompilationErrorHandler errorHandler)
           
 void generateClassOrObject(JetClassOrObject classOrObject)
           
 java.util.Collection<JetFile> getFiles()
           
 PackageParts getPackageParts()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

PackageCodegen

public PackageCodegen(@NotNull
                      GenerationState state,
                      @NotNull
                      java.util.Collection<JetFile> files,
                      @NotNull
                      FqName fqName)
Method Detail

generate

public void generate(@NotNull
                     CompilationErrorHandler errorHandler)

generateClassOrObject

public void generateClassOrObject(@NotNull
                                  JetClassOrObject classOrObject)

done

public void done()

getPackageParts

public PackageParts getPackageParts()

getFiles

public java.util.Collection<JetFile> getFiles()